🧬 Your DNA Can Store Every Movie Ever Made (Literally)
Sounds like sci-fi? It’s real science. DNA — the molecule of life — can now store zettabytes of digital information.
📦 DNA = Storage Drive?
One gram of DNA can store over 215 petabytes (215 million GB) of data — more than all Netflix servers combined.
📈 Real-World Example
Scientists encoded:
– Shakespeare’s sonnets
– A full operating system
– A 1895 French film
All inside synthetic DNA.
🧪 How It Works
1. Convert binary data to DNA base code (A, T, C, G)
2. Synthesize that DNA strand
3. Decode it back to binary later using sequencing
🧠 Why It’s Game-Changing
– DNA lasts thousands of years
– Compact: 1 room = all world’s data
– Eco-friendly: No electricity needed for storage
🎯 What’s the Catch?
– Slow to read/write (not for daily use)
– Expensive (for now)
– Needs advanced lab setup
🌍 Future Uses
– Long-term archiving (government records, medical data)
– Space missions (DNA survives radiation)
– Bio-cloud storage
